J17 MMA is a 2006 Land Rover Range Rover in Black with a 4,196cc petrol engine. This vehicle has been through 21 MOT tests with a personal pass rate of 81%.
Across all 2006 Land Rover Range Rover models, the average MOT pass rate is 77.1% with a typical mileage of 96,967 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Land Rover Range Rover fails its MOT is brake pipe excessively corroded, accounting for 63,439 recorded failures. If you're considering buying J17 MMA, it's worth having these areas checked by a mechanic before committing.
The Land Rover Range Rover typically stays on UK roads for around 39 years. At 20 years old, this Land Rover Range Rover is well into its expected lifespan but still has years ahead.
